Possible Causes of HVAC Discharge Line Issues

When your air conditioning system’s discharge line becomes clogged or damaged, it can lead to water leaks and potential water damage to your property. Common causes include dirt, debris, or mold buildup within the line, which obstructs proper drainage. Over time, aging or corrosion can weaken the piping, increasing the risk of cracks or leaks. Additionally, improper installation or sudden temperature changes can stress the discharge line, causing it to crack or disconnect, resulting in water issues.

Weather conditions in Westminster, such as high humidity or heavy rainfall, can also contribute to discharge line problems. These elements may accelerate wear and tear or promote mold growth inside the line. Ignoring signs of discharge line failure can lead to more significant water damage, mold development, and even HVAC system breakdown. Recognizing early indications of discharge line issues is essential to prevent costly repairs and protect your property.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the signs of a faulty HVAC discharge line?

Common signs include unexplained water pooling around your HVAC unit, persistent leaks, mold growth near the system, or a noticeable decrease in cooling efficiency. If you hear hissing or see debris buildup, itโ€™s time to have your discharge line inspected.

Can I fix a damaged discharge line myself?

While minor clogs might be manageable, working with HVAC discharge lines often requires expertise and specialized tools. Attempting repairs without proper knowledge can result in further damage or voiding warranties. Itโ€™s best to rely on qualified professionals for safe and effective repairs.

How often should I have my discharge line inspected?

Scheduling professional inspections annually can help catch issues early before they cause significant water damage. Regular maintenance ensures your HVAC system remains efficient and extends its lifespan, especially in a humid climate like Westminster’s.

Will a repaired discharge line prevent water damage?

Yes. Properly repairing or replacing a faulty discharge line guarantees that your system drains correctly, preventing leaks and water pooling. This avoids potential mold growth and property damage, safeguarding your home and health.
